How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Flushing Meadows?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Flushing Meadows Studio Apartments | $1,967 | $1,900 | $2,050 |
Flushing Meadows 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,332 | $1,850 | $2,900 |
| Flushing Meadows 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,938 | $2,500 | $3,650 |
| Flushing Meadows 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,233 | $3,100 | $3,400 |
